How much do main event j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average hourly pay for main event in Oregon is $18.22,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.24 and $20.34 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Main Event employee?

A Main Event employee works at Main Event Entertainment centers, which are venues offering activities like bowling, laser tag, arcade games, and dining. Employees can have various roles, such as party host, server, game attendant, or kitchen staff, each focused on providing a fun and safe experience for guests. Main Event team members are known for their customer service skills and ability to create memorable events for families, groups, and parties. They often work flexible hours, including evenings and weekends, and may receive training in hospitality or event management.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Main Event team member?

To thrive as a Main Event Team Member, you need strong customer service skills, attention to detail, and basic math abilities, typically sup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, food safety certifications, and event management tools is often beneficial. Exceptional teamwork, communication, and problem-solving skills help individuals stand out in this role. These skills ensure smooth guest experiences, efficient operations, and a positive, energetic atmosphere for both customers and staff.

What are some common challenges faced by team members working at Main Event, and how can they be addressed?

Team members at Main Event often work in a fast-paced, high-energy environment where they must juggle multiple tasks, such as assisting guests, operating attractions, and maintaining cleanliness. A common challenge is managing busy periods, especially during weekends or special events, which requires effective time management and strong communication skills. Addressing these challenges involves staying organized, collaborating closely with coworkers, and proactively seeking support from supervisors when needed. Main Event provides training and emphasizes teamwork, helping employees navigate busy times and deliver excellent guest experiences.

Based in St. Louis, Core & Main is a leader in advancing reliable infrastructure with local service, nationwide. As a specialty distributor with a focus on water, wastewater, storm drainage and fire protection products and related services, Core & Main provides solutions to municipalities, private water companies and professional contractors across municipal, non-residential and residential end markets, nationwide. With over 370 locations across the U.S., the company provides its customers local expertise backed by a national supply chain. Core & Main's 5,700 associates are committed to helping their communities thrive with safe and reliable infrastructure. Visitcoreandmain.comto learn more.
